Establishing Your Remodeling Project Budget
How should homeowners approach budgeting for their remodeling endeavors? First, they should define the scope of the renovation, identifying essential upgrades versus desired enhancements. Setting a clear direction enables better spending prioritization. Following this, homeowners need to research and obtain bids from contractors, confirming they factor in labor, materials, and potential surprise costs. It's wise to set aside an extra 10-20% of the overall budget for contingencies, since unexpected problems frequently occur during renovations.
Property owners should also evaluate financing options when required, such as personal loans or home equity lines of credit, to make certain they have sufficient funds. Comparing different contractors and their proposals can lead to better pricing and value. Finally, regularly reviewing the budget throughout the project helps maintain financial control and allows for adjustments as needed. By implementing these strategies, homeowners can create a realistic budget that encourages a successful remodeling experience.

Latest Design Styles
While homeowners look to customize their living linked article areas, modern design movements show a shift towards sustainability and functionality. Environmentally conscious materials, such as reclaimed wood and bamboo, are becoming more popular, demonstrating a growing awareness of environmental impact. Minimalist design is also gaining traction, focusing on clean lines and uncluttered spaces that promote a sense of calm. Multi-functional furniture, such as convertible sofas and expandable dining tables, addresses the need for versatility in smaller homes. Furthermore, biophilic design, which incorporates natural elements, is gaining momentum as people aim to connect with nature indoors. Color palettes are shifting towards earthy tones, producing warm and inviting atmospheres. These patterns jointly stress creating spaces that are not only beautiful but also practical and sustainable.

Which Permits Do You Need for Remodeling Projects?
Typically, homeowners need permits for building, electrical work, and plumbing, and in some cases zoning permits for remodeling projects. Requirements vary by location, so it's crucial to consult local building codes and authorities before starting your renovation project.
